Abstract
The invention discloses a cleaning control method and system of a heat exchanger for a clothes dryer and the clothes dryer. The cleaning control system of the heat exchanger comprises a water collector for collecting condensate water, a water storage tank, a water spray head and a pump body, wherein the water spray head is provided with three water nozzles and two water through holes; and a control valve is arranged between each water through hole and the water storage tank and used for controlling the connection/separation between the corresponding water through hole and the water storage tank. The cleaning control method comprises the following steps: detecting the cleanliness of three-section parts of the heat exchanger, wherein the three-section parts of the heat exchanger include a left part, a middle part and a right part; judging the cleanliness of the three-section parts to obtain judgment results; and controlling the control valves according to the judgment results to correspondingly clean the left part, middle part and right part of the heat exchanger through the three water nozzles respectively. In the invention, the effluent of corresponding water nozzles is controlled by detecting the cleanliness of the three-section parts of the heat exchanger; the left part, middle part and right part of the heat exchanger are cleaned respectively; and the cleaning effect is good, and useless cleaning is avoided.
